Scholarship: British Council IELTS Scholarship 2011
Scholarship amount: Eight scholars will receive an award to the value of Rs.3,00,000 each.
Eligibility:
- The applicants must be a resident and citizen of India.
- Must begin full time postgraduate study outside India in 2011.
- Attend a higher education institution that accepts IELTS as part of its admission requirements. Have a valid IELTS score, with a minimum band score average 6.5.
- Must be able to provide an acceptance letter from the attending institution by 13 August 2011

Selection process: Short-listing will be carried out by the British Council. The final eight winning scholars will be chosen by a panel from the higher education and / or corporate sectors in India. The shortlisted students will be required to make a short presentation and attend an interview. The panel will decide on the winning students after the interview.
